What is a research assistant biomedical sciences?

Research Assistants in Biomedical Sciences are professionals who support scientific investigations in areas like human health, disease, and medical technology. They assist with laboratory experiments, data collection, analysis, and maintaining lab equipment. Their work is essential for advancing research projects, ensuring accuracy in results, and supporting the overall objectives of their research teams. Typically, they work under the supervision of senior scientists or principal investigators and may also contribute to preparing reports or scientific publications.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a research assistant biomedical sciences?

To thrive as a Research Assistant in Biomedical Sciences, you need a solid background in biology, laboratory techniques, and data analysis, typically sup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in a relevant field. Familiarity with laboratory equipment, statistical analysis software (such as SPSS or GraphPad Prism), and compliance with safety protocols is essential.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ication help you excel in supporting complex research projects and collaborating with team members. These skills ensure accurate data collection, reliable results, and smooth teamwork, which are critical for advancing biomedical research.

What are some common challenges faced by research assistants biomedical sciences and how can they be managed?

Research Assistants in Biomedical Sciences often encounter challenges such as balancing multiple projects, meeting tight deadlines, and adapting to evolving experimental protocols. Managing these challenges involves effective time management, staying organized with detailed lab notes, and maintaining open communication with supervisors and team members. Additionally, being proactive in seeking feedback and support when troubleshooting experiments can help ensure research progresses smoothly and efficiently.
